PAQUIN SR., MR. JOSEPH PAUL Muskegon Mr. Joseph Paul Paquin, Sr., age 58, passed away unexpectedly Sunday, May 16, 2010. Joe was born December 31, 1951 to Thomas Victor and Lorraine (Lipps) Paquin. Joe served his country in the National Guard during the Vietnam War. He had worked for Trophy...
